We rent the house out for weddings and other special parties, corporate away days or just a get together for families and friends which because of its location in the Limpley Stoke/Monkton Combe valleys, provides a stunning setting with gorgeous examples of gentle English landscapes.
The valley is a communications centre and contains the main road between Bath and Warminster, the River Avon, a railway line and the Kennett & Avon canal, close to the Dundas Basin and Aquaduct. Pendragon has it's own small canal boat, the Charlotte Dundas and as guests, you have full access to her, for trips to Bath or Bradford upon Avon - all with no locks to navigate through, just a swing-bridge or two. There are thre pubs on the canal:- the George at Bathampton, the Cross Guns at Avoncliffe and Fun With Dick and Jane at Bradford - all offer food. The canal path allows immediate access to the countryside with bicycles, and the river Avon, and there are a myriad number of public footpaths that criss-cross the valley to many beautlful villages and points of interest.
